摘要: 目的 探讨磷脂酶C-γ1(PLC-γ1)信号通路被阻断对大肠癌细胞凋亡状态的影响。方法 利用U73122(1、5、10μmol/L)处理细胞以阻断PLC-γ1信号通路,光镜、电镜观察细胞形态改变,MTT法评估细胞杀伤效应,流式细胞仪分析凋亡细胞比例。结果 PLC-γ1信号通路阻断后,大肠癌细胞出现了典型的凋亡形态学改变,存活细胞明显减少,流式细胞仪检测出现典型的凋亡亚二倍体峰,凋亡细胞所占比例达到半数以上。结论 阻断PLC-γ1信号通路能够启动大肠癌细胞凋亡。

Abstract: Objective To investigate the effects of inhibiting phospholipase C gamma1 signaling pathway on the apoptosis of human colorectal carcinoma cells. Methods SW620 cells were treated with U73122 in vitro to inhibit the phospholipase C gamma1 signalling pathway and examined under light microscope and transmission electron microscope for analyzing changes in apoptotic behavior of the cells. MTT assay was used to evaluate the cell killing effects, and the percentage of apoptotic cells analyzed using flow cytometry. Results After inhibition of the phospholipase C gamma1 signaling pathway by U73122, SW620 cells exhibited obvious apoptotic morphology, the viable cells decreased dramatically, and the percentage of apoptotic cells rose to above 50%. Conclusion Inhibition of phospholipase C gamma1 signaling pathway can induce apoptosis of human colorectal carcinoma cells.
